Kalahi-CIDSS-ADB funds P1.4B projects in Iloilo Province

 The Kapit-Bisig Laban sa Kahirapan-Comprehensive and Integrated Delivery of Social Service through the Asian Development Bank has provided P1.4 billion worth of projects in the province of Iloilo. The P1.4 billion covers the construction of 1,994 small-scale projects in 33 municipalities from 2014 to the present. Kalahi-CIDSS funds P756.7M projects in Antique

The province of Antique received a total grant of P756.7M from Kapit-Bisig Laban sa Kahirapan-Comprehensive and Integrated Delivery of Social Service through the Asian Development Bank.  The P756.7 million grant covers 780 projects in the 16 municipalities. DSWD gives P7.1M in transportation aid for Boracay’s displaced workers

THE Department of Social Welfare Development (DSWD) Field Office VI released P7.1 million in transportation assistance to Boracay’s displaced workers.
